youtube.com's social setup currently has 2 warnings that affect how it renders on Twitter / X. The most impactful fixes are listed below - they range from missing required tags to image dimensions that will be cropped or rejected by specific platforms.

In particular: missing og:type tag; missing twitter:card tag. Each of these has a one-line fix in the recommendations panel above.
